Here’s why People are Infuriated about Lenovo Laptops Today

Chinese computer maker Lenovo has actually been caught in secret installing its own proprietary software on Windows, and the software appears impossible to get rid of.

Many users noticed that Lenovo computers were downloading an application named as “Lenovo Service Engine” to their machine, and would reinstall even after a fresh reboot of the Windows operating system was performed.

Ars Technical noticed the problem through forum user “ge814” about a week before, reported The Next Web, and presents a safety risk, since forcing a computer to download programs could be an entry for hackers to install similar malware.

The company since issued a statement saying this safety vulnerability through an update, and that this scrap would be installed in all new manufactured Lenovo computers. This follows the “Super fish” disaster for the company in February, whereby a preloaded piece of software called Super fish potentially allowed hacker’s user’s traffic. Lenovo knotted to issue a patch and a confession: “We messed up poorly,” Lenovo’s chief technology officer Peter Hortensius, told CNET, that the company was unaware in making public traffic.

It remains to be seen if these missteps will have an effect on Lenovo’s standing as the world’s biggest computer vendor. Last year, the company shipped 16 million units, and had the major PC market share at around 19.9%, according to IDC.

Slagging Slow? Here’s How to Make Your Computer Run Faster


Your computer may get blocked up with unwanted files, unused software’s and other digital fragments that can cause a sluggish performance. So you don’t need to do complete reinstall. You can simply speed up your computer for free. Here are the 10 simple tips that can help in running your PC faster.

  • Simply Get Rid of Unwanted Programs

Uninstall the unwanted programs and free up your memory space. These may contain trial versions of software’s that came along with the computer when you buy it, outdated anti-virus programs, old versions software that you no longer make use of.
Click on the Start > Control Panel > Uninstall a program. From the list of programs that appears on your screen, click the program you may want to uninstall, and then simply click Uninstall.

  • Remove the Temporary Files

Disk Clean-up function can help in boosting your system’s performance by removing the temporary files. Click Start. Type ‘disk clean-up’ in the search box and, from the list of results that appears on the screen, click on Disk Clean-up. Click the files you want to clean.

  • Regularly Restart Your Computer

Restarting your computer clears out its space. Also it closes all the programs that are running on the backhand of the PC, so it’s a good point if your system is running slow or behave weirdly.

10 Amazing Tips for Choosing the Best Laptop for You



Buying the correct laptop can be one of the most significant decisions you make. The last thing you would like to do is spend a lot of money and find out later that you didn't purchase the best laptop for your exact needs. Choosing the best laptop is not always a simple decision. Laptops come in a selection of sizes, specifications, colors, and prices. Here are some instructions to keep in my mind when looking for the correct laptop for you.

·         Laptops are not as simple to upgrade as desktops. It is hard to replace some of the hardware, such as the hard drive. Some laptop producer does not even permit this to be done at all. It is significant to look for laptops that permit upgrades. For example, an extra memory slot is a characteristic you may want in a laptop. You may not feel as if this is a vital feature, but it can go a long way in the output of your laptop.

·         Choosing the accurate processor is significant. The computer determines the pace of your computer when running applications. Many laptops nowadays come with dual core processors and quad core processors.

·         People love laptops because they are transportable. When choosing a laptop, you desire to think its portability. If a laptop weighs a lot, it will more than likely be a weight to carry around. If there is a good possibility you will be taking your laptop with you when you go places, you may desire to consider a thin laptop.

·         Laptops generally come with 3-cell or 6-cell batteries. Laptops with 3-cell batteries are frequently cheaper and do not have a battery life as long as 6-cell battery laptops. If you plan to use your laptop chiefly at home, a 3-cell battery may be sufficient. If you plan to travel a lot with your laptop, you may want to decide one with a 6-cell battery.

·         Having the correct amount of memory is very significant when choosing the best laptops. Standard laptops come with 256 or 512 MB of memory. This is sufficient for simple laptop use. If you are going to run more than a few programs at the same time or play games on your laptop, you may want to opt for a laptop with more memory.

·         As mentioned before, it is tricky to replace a hard drive in a laptop. Therefore, it is significant to think about the quantity of hard disk space you will call for. If price is a matter, you can always buy an outside hard drive at a later time.
